Brief Biography

Alison Camden was an undergraduate student majoring in Biochemistry at the University of Illinois at Urbana-Champaign. She performed undergraduate research under the supervision of Prof. Scott K. Silverman. After graduation, she was in the developmental biology graduate program at Washington University in St. Louis. She then became a science teacher at Bernard Middle School in St. Louis.     

Research Interests

In my research project, I identified deoxyribozymes that phosphorylate oligonucleotides at their 3'-termini.
